Costs - not too bad these days, most of the "classics" can be had for between $500 and $1000
depending on condition. According to KLOV the current
top 10 collectible games are:
1. Pac-Man
2. Galaga
3. Donkey Kong
4. Star Wars
5. Ms. Pac-Man
6. Dig Dug
7. Asteroids
8. Defender
9. Tron
10. Tempest (tie)
10. Centipede (tie)
Of course those aren't the ones I have in MY game room at home (old photos, the
collection has changed quite a bit since then!), I currently have Tempest, Star Wars, Joust,
Centipede, Rampart, Asteroids Deluxe, Battle Zone, Donkey Kong and a couple of pinball machines.
The real challenge isn't acquiring the games, it is keeping them up and running, after 20-30 years
they take a certain amount of maintenance to keep running.
